KUALA TERENGGANU: Kijal assemblyman Datuk Seri Ahmad Said, who tabled a motion of no-confidence against the Mentri Besar, was nowhere to be seen at the state assembly sitting on Wednesday.

However, his aim to dethrone Mentri Besar Datuk Seri Ahmad Razif Abdul Rahman is expected to be pursued by the 14 PAS and one PKR opposition assemblymen.
